COURSE DESCRIPTION
Secondary Level Government Course (IGCSE, GCSE, WAEC SSCE): Our secondary level government course is designed to provide students with a comprehensive understanding of political systems, governance structures, and civic responsibilities. Covering topics such as political ideologies, constitutions, electoral processes, and the role of government institutions, our curriculum combines theoretical knowledge with real-world examples and case studies. Through interactive discussions, debates, and simulations, students develop critical thinking skills and analytical abilities to assess political issues and make informed judgments. We emphasize the importance of civic engagement and ethical leadership, preparing students to participate actively in democratic processes and contribute positively to their communities.
A-Level Government Course (JAMB, A-Level): For students pursuing A-Level qualifications such as JAMB and A-Level examinations, our government course offers advanced study in political theory, comparative politics, international relations, and public policy analysis. The curriculum delves into complex political systems, global governance challenges, and the impact of political ideologies on societies. Students engage in in-depth research projects, policy debates, and case studies to deepen their understanding of government functions and political dynamics. Our experienced instructors mentor students to develop strong analytical and research skills, preparing them for higher education and careers in fields such as political science, law, public administration, and international relations.
Each level of our government course is designed to foster a critical understanding of governance structures, political processes, and civic responsibilities, equipping students with the knowledge and skills to engage meaningfully in civic life and pursue careers in public service and policy-making.
